Abstract
Antibiotics are a group of drugs that treat different bacterial infections. However, inappropriate use of antibiotics such as overuse (used when they are not needed) or use for the wrong reason can lead to antibiotic resistance (bacteria that are harder to treat). Patient knowledge of antibiotics is considered an important contributing factor for antibiotic misuse. Thus, this study was conducted to evaluate patient knowledge about antibiotic misuse and resistance among a population of Hail in the northern part of Saudi Arabia.
